Have you noticed a slew of new restaurants you’ve never seen or heard of before while recently scrolling through your favorite delivery app? That is likely due to the rise in ghost kitchens — communal kitchens where chefs prepare meals for delivery only, completely cutting the overhead costs of owning and operating a dine-in restaurant.
While the concept isn’t new, ghost kitchens have been on the rise in Atlanta over the last year thanks to the pandemic and a massive spike in delivery orders and at-home dining. Some highlights include Guy Fieri’s Flavortown Kitchen, Fazoli’s, MattChews, Chicken Out and Scotch Yard.
